- Netflix has released a trailer for Dave Chappelle's upcoming comedy special, 'The Dreamer', which is set to premiere on New Year's Eve.
- The trailer features narration by Morgan Freeman and was filmed at the Lincoln Theatre in Washington D.C.
- 'The Dreamer' is Chappelle's seventh Netflix special and the first since 'The Closer', which received criticism for being homophobic and transphobic.
- In the new special, Chappelle discusses a May 2022 incident where he was attacked on stage in Los Angeles and the 'slap' at the Oscars that same year.
- Chappelle has faced backlash for his controversial humor, with a venue in Minneapolis canceling a show he was scheduled to host in July 2022 due to protests.
